•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Custom IC Design
  3. Require Help regarding adding custom layer/extraction in...

Stats

  • Locked Locked
  • Replies 1
  • Subscribers 126
  • Views 716
  • Members are here 0
This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

Require Help regarding adding custom layer/extraction in GPDK45nm

Ryan18IITDelhi
Ryan18IITDelhi over 7 years ago

Hi All, 

I am using gpdk 45nm & require some help regarding adding custom OXIDE  layer in Virtuoso layer  (say COXIDE). I am able to add custom layer in the layer pallete and draw it. But i have the below queries. 

1) How can i set the sheet resistance / capacitance values for the layer  and use the values in actual layout ? 

2) How do i query the above properties once set ? 

3) Can i do extraction and dump spice netlists for poly-COXIDE-poly ? 

4) Can i dump all required views for the poly-COXIDE-poly - like spectre / ivpcell / hspiceD ?  (i.e all the views other predefined cell has) 

Thanks & Regards,

Ryan_IITD

  • Cancel
Parents
  • Quek
    Quek over 7 years ago

    Hi Ryan

    Here are my comments:

    1. Would you please provide more details on how you would like the values to be used? E.g. allow the values to be used by an auto-router? To be able to specify dimensions of devices with COXIDE layer based on the values?

    2. You can get the values using SKILL. E.g.
    tf=techGetTechFile(ddGetObj("gpdk045"))
    techGetLayerProp(tf "Metal1" "sheetResistance")

    3. Yes. It is possible to do it. You need to make the appropriate changes in LVS deck and Quantus package

    4. Yes, it is possible to create spectre, etc views. I think you meant this:
    - Create poly-coxide-poly as a device
    - Create a symbol view for it
    - Copy symbol view as auCdl, spectre and hspiceD views


    Thanks
    Quek

    • Cancel
    • Vote Up 0 Vote Down
    • Cancel
Reply
  • Quek
    Quek over 7 years ago

    Hi Ryan

    Here are my comments:

    1. Would you please provide more details on how you would like the values to be used? E.g. allow the values to be used by an auto-router? To be able to specify dimensions of devices with COXIDE layer based on the values?

    2. You can get the values using SKILL. E.g.
    tf=techGetTechFile(ddGetObj("gpdk045"))
    techGetLayerProp(tf "Metal1" "sheetResistance")

    3. Yes. It is possible to do it. You need to make the appropriate changes in LVS deck and Quantus package

    4. Yes, it is possible to create spectre, etc views. I think you meant this:
    - Create poly-coxide-poly as a device
    - Create a symbol view for it
    - Copy symbol view as auCdl, spectre and hspiceD views


    Thanks
    Quek

    • Cancel
    • Vote Up 0 Vote Down
    • Cancel
Children
No Data

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information